LAHORE, Sept 26: The senior Punjab minister has ordered immediate re-opening of the bridge at Head Panjnad for light traffic to save travelers from inconvenience.
He also called for an explanation report for delay in starting the repair work from the irrigation chief engineer, Bahawalpur zone, a handout said here on Friday.
The minister was informed that the bridge had been closed to traffic for over a fortnight while no work had so far been initiated on it. He was further informed that closure and inordinate delay in construction was causing great problems for commuters and the local people.
At a meeting of senior officials and engineers of related departments held here, the minister directed that the bridge be opened forthwith, and during the construction, a service lane should be arranged as an alternate route for travelers. — APP
